The Concept Behind the Title

The phrase “how to get to heaven” works as a metaphor for seeking transcendence through sound. In the context of Belfast, it reflects the city’s long‑standing tradition of turning hardship into art. The creators frame the journey as a series of musical milestones—each song, each lyric, each rhythm is a step toward an imagined “heaven” of creative fulfillment.

Why Belfast Matters

Belfast’s music scene is a tapestry of influences: traditional Irish folk, punk’s raw edge, and a growing electronic underground. Episode 1 draws on this diversity, showcasing how local venues, street performers, and community radio stations contribute to a collective sound that feels both grounded and aspirational.

Key Themes Explored in Episode 1

Episode 1 introduces three core ideas that recur throughout the series.

  1. Search for Meaning: The hosts discuss how music can serve as a compass when life feels directionless, likening the search for “heaven” to the search for purpose.
  2. Community Connection: Interviews with local musicians illustrate how shared experiences on stage and in rehearsal rooms build a sense of belonging that feels almost spiritual.
  3. Creative Risk: The episode encourages listeners to step outside comfort zones—whether that means trying a new instrument, writing lyrics in a different language, or performing in an unfamiliar venue.
